Mr. Mike called me yesterday evening to discuss the problem with my tractor. He said the mechanic did not find anything. The very first models that moved the shifter to the side had trouble with the linkage, but since mine is only a couple of months old it already had the upgrade. He explained that the gears had to stop in order to mesh. This means pushing the clutch in and giving it time to slow down then try to shift. Also, when shifting from 2 to 3 make sure not to use a z-pattern but rather go to neutral then across then into 3rd. He said it will probably just take time to get used to the way it shifts but should be okay. He insisted if I have any more problems to let him know. In short, the extra linkage it took to move the shifter to the side makes it harder to shift and more apt to bend if forced.
